Anyway, I played the PES 2016 demo today and really enjoyed it. Much of the gameplay feels like what I said on last year's title, but what impressed me was the tweaks to make it feel more tactically realistic. In terms of gameplay, I felt I had to think more when out of possession to press the opponents correctly. My general approach was to press off the ball well and when in possession break aggressively and quickly. This meant I'd often end up with less possession during matches, but I'd be in complete control of the match with my pressing. Alternatively, I also felt that if I wanted to play a more possession based game, I really could by utilising the passing game.
There's also new tactical options available this year. Most notably, you can set tactics in various phases of the game, such as your standard formation at kick off, the formation of the side when attacking and the formation of the side when defending. That ability to adjust the team's shape to different scenarios really excites me, but more than that, you can adjust how the team plays/behaves (e.g. how they press, focus in positioning or style) in these different scenarios. That could open up a level of detail in the tactical aspects of the game not seen before. I've not played with it too much, but I'm very excited in testing it out.
